Billiton forms RI venture
LONDON (Dow Jones): Billiton PLC said Wednesday that it has signed a joint venture agreement with Winnin Pty. Ltd and PT Taraco Mining to explore for coal in Indonesia.
Winnin is a wholly owned subsidiary of Nissho Iwai Corp. of Japan. Taraco is an Indonesian registered company holding a coal contract of work awarded by the Indonesian government.
The CCOW permits exploration of coal in an area of East Kalimantan, located immediately adjacent to the existing Kaltim Prima Coal operation.
Billiton and Winnin will acquire 51 percent and 9 percent respectively of Taraco for US$1.2 million required under the terms of the CCOW. Billiton and Winnin will additionally provide funding for the exploration process, Taraco refunding their share of expenditure if mining takes place.
